Euro dips on possible ECB softer stance

Published Wed, Jun 7, 2017 · 09:50 PM

London

THE euro fell more than half a per cent on Wednesday after a report suggesting the European Central Bank, rather than swinging decisively towards a tighter monetary stance this week, is preparing to cut its outlook for inflation.
